O que é Bot?
Um bot, abreviação de “robot” (robô em inglês), é um programa de computador que realiza tarefas automatizadas na internet. Esses programas são criados para simular ações humanas e podem ser utilizados para diversas finalidades, desde a interação em redes sociais até a realização de tarefas mais complexas, como a coleta de dados ou a execução de transações online.
Tipos de Bots
Existem diferentes tipos de bots, cada um com suas características e finalidades específicas. Alguns dos principais tipos de bots são:
1. Bots de Redes Sociais
Os bots de redes sociais são programas criados para interagir com usuários em plataformas como Facebook, Twitter, Instagram, entre outras. Esses bots podem ser utilizados para enviar mensagens automáticas, curtir publicações, seguir perfis, entre outras ações. Alguns bots de redes sociais são criados para fins maliciosos, como a disseminação de spam ou a propagação de notícias falsas.
2. Bots de Busca
Os bots de busca são programas utilizados pelos motores de busca, como o Google, para indexar e analisar o conteúdo presente na internet. Esses bots percorrem os sites e coletam informações sobre as páginas, como o título, a descrição e as palavras-chave. Essas informações são utilizadas pelos motores de busca para exibir os resultados mais relevantes para as pesquisas dos usuários.
3. Bots de Compra
Os bots de compra são programas utilizados para automatizar o processo de compra em lojas online. Esses bots podem ser programados para realizar buscas por produtos, comparar preços, adicionar itens ao carrinho de compras e finalizar a transação. Esses bots podem ser utilizados tanto por consumidores para economizar tempo e encontrar as melhores ofertas, quanto por revendedores para obter vantagens competitivas.
4. Bots de Atendimento
Os bots de atendimento são programas utilizados para realizar o atendimento ao cliente de forma automatizada. Esses bots podem ser programados para responder perguntas frequentes, fornecer informações sobre produtos e serviços, agendar atendimentos, entre outras ações. Esses bots são cada vez mais utilizados por empresas para agilizar o atendimento ao cliente e reduzir custos.
5. Bots Maliciosos
Os bots maliciosos são programas criados com o intuito de realizar atividades prejudiciais na internet. Esses bots podem ser utilizados para disseminar vírus, realizar ataques de negação de serviço (DDoS), roubar informações pessoais, entre outros crimes cibernéticos. Esses bots representam uma ameaça à segurança na internet e requerem medidas de proteção para evitar danos.
Como os Bots Funcionam?
Os bots funcionam através de algoritmos e scripts que definem suas ações automatizadas. Esses programas podem ser programados para realizar tarefas específicas, como enviar mensagens, preencher formulários, clicar em links, entre outras ações. Os bots podem ser configurados para funcionar de forma contínua, realizando as tarefas de forma repetitiva, ou podem ser ativados apenas em determinados momentos, de acordo com a necessidade do usuário.
Benefícios e Desafios dos Bots
Os bots oferecem diversos benefícios, como a automatização de tarefas repetitivas, a agilidade no atendimento ao cliente, a coleta de dados em larga escala, entre outros. No entanto, também apresentam desafios, como a necessidade de atualização constante para evitar detecção e bloqueio, a possibilidade de utilização para fins maliciosos e a falta de personalização no atendimento ao cliente.
Como Identificar um Bot?
A identificação de um bot pode ser um desafio, pois esses programas são criados para simular ações humanas. No entanto, existem alguns indícios que podem ajudar a identificar a presença de um bot, como a repetição de ações em curtos intervalos de tempo, a falta de interação humana em conversas, a utilização de linguagem automatizada e a realização de tarefas em horários não usuais.
Como se Proteger dos Bots?
Para se proteger dos bots, é importante adotar algumas medidas de segurança, como a utilização de sistemas de detecção de bots, a implementação de captchas em formulários, a atualização constante de softwares e sistemas operacionais, a utilização de firewalls e antivírus, entre outras medidas. Além disso, é importante estar atento a comportamentos suspeitos e denunciar atividades maliciosas.
Conclusão
Em resumo, os bots são programas de computador que realizam tarefas automatizadas na internet. Esses programas podem ser utilizados para diversas finalidades, desde a interação em redes sociais até a realização de transações online. No entanto, é importante estar atento aos riscos e adotar medidas de segurança para se proteger dos bots maliciosos.